Responsibilities

AVP of Workforce Management oversees the development and implementation of enterprise-wide performance management procedures and strategies that support organizational goals and initiatives including operational and financial impacts of performance metrics.

  • Acts as regional representative for workforce management team and initiatives
  • Maintains infrastructure to ensure regional labor management reporting is accurate
  • Executes key performance indicators (KPIs)
  • Develops, oversees, and improves daily operations, policies, systems and procedures
  • Assists Senior Director and Regional Leadership with labor strategic plans that align with the organization’s overall goals & objectives
  • Provides guidance and support to Market Managers on labor management initiatives and systems
  • Leads and manages projects related to labor management, including implementation of new systems, processes, and technologies
  • Works in collaboration with other departments, such as HR, Nursing and Finance to align labor management strategies with overall business goals
  • Participates in the annual budget process, setting of volumes, targets, dollars and rates
  • Ensures implementation of productivity changes are achieved
  • Lead projects related to labor management, including implementation of new systems, processes, and technologies
  • Operates with minimal supervision
  • Travel for projects and other field visits as required

Ascension is a leading non-profit, faith-based national health system made up of over 134,000 associates and 2,600 sites of care, including more than 140 hospitals and 40 senior living communities in 19 states.
